
Transit Driver (Must have a CDL with Passenger Endorsement)
RATP Dev USA, Ocala, FL, United States
Transit Bus Driver
Transit Bus Driver for RATP Dev USA at the SunTran location. You don’t have to worry if you’ve never driven a Transit Bus before. RATP Dev USA will teach and pay you while you train! The position is full time; part time is also available.
Salary
$17.50 per hour.
Work Environment
Growth opportunities.
Qualifications
CDL Class A or B with Airbrakes and Passenger Endorsement (preferred)
High school diploma or equivalent preferred
Excellent customer service experience
Excellent driving record
Availability to work varying shifts, hours, days, and locations
Must pass a physical examination and alcohol/drug test
Must be knowledgeable of the Ocala Street network
Maintain a satisfactory level on work performance evaluations
Special sensitivity for the needs of transit‑dependent, elderly, and disabled passengers
Responsibilities
Transport customers and assist them with important travel decisions
Maintain a clean and professional demeanor and appearance
Support customers with travel‑related questions and issues
Collect and report passenger fares and ridership accurately and honestly
Assist customers using wheelchairs or other mobility devices
Communicate with team members and complete written reports and forms
Adhere to all Department of Transportation (DOT) regulations and guidelines
Conduct pre‑trip and post‑trip inspections, noting any mechanical failures on an Operator Daily Report Sheet / Bus Log Sheet
Adhere to fixed‑route procedures, including making verbal announcements of major intersections along the designated route
Other duties as assigned
Physical Demands
Sitting, walking, standing, bending, twisting, squatting, climbing, kneeling, grasping, pushing/pulling, reaching, and lifting/carrying 0‑30 pounds.
Benefits
Paid vacation, sick leave, and holidays
Company medical, dental, and vision plan for you and your family
Company pension plan and other benefits
8‑week paid training program
Professional development and growth opportunities
Schedule
Monday to Friday, weekend availability
8‑hour shift
Day, evening, morning, night shift options
Part time available with training Monday‑Friday
Experience Level
1 year.
